At the convergence of Argentina’s Lanin National Park and Chile’s Villarrica National Park, Lanin Volcano stands as one of Patagonia’s highest mountains. Located near San Martin de los Andes, this snow-covered volcano is distinguished by its perfectly conical peak. Adventurers and hikers are drawn to the challenging summit hike, which offers a rewarding experience for those who undertake it. The volcano’s symmetrical shape and snowy cap make it a striking sight, and visitors can explore the surrounding national parks, immersing themselves in the natural beauty of the Andean landscape.
